High Holiday Babysitting & Tot Services
Beth El will offer babysitting for children from 3 months – 5 years of age on both days of Rosh Hashanah and on Yom Kippur. The charge for daytime babysitting is $3.50 per child per day with a maximum charge of $25 per family. We will also offer babysitting at no charge for Erev Rosh Hashanah and Kol Nidre services.
We are pleased that ”Miss Patty” Nogg will again be leading special Tot Services on the first day of Rosh Hashanah and on Yom Kippur for 3-5 year olds. She will lead the children in songs, stories and activities appropriate for the High Holy days. These services will be held in the Chapel from 11:30 a.m. – 12:15 p.m. on the first day of Rosh Hashanah and on Yom Kippur. There is no charge to attend but an adult must accompany each child attending. Children under 3 are welcome, but this service is aimed at 3-5 year olds and their parents. If you are registering your children for babysitting, you or another adult will need to pick them up, bring them to this service and stay with them. This year babysitters will not be bringing the children to “Miss Patty’s” service. Since we are serving a light snack, we need to know if you are planning on attending, so we can make sure we have enough food for all children attending.
